Why Cats And Dogs Do The Weird Things That They Do

We don’t always understand why our pets do the weird things they do. However, when looking into their past (before they were domesticated), we can find some likely answers. Dogs are domesticated wolves, so social wolf pack behaviors explain a lot of what they do. Meanwhile, cats were lonesome hunters, with a variety of adaptations that they haven’t yet lost. Some of the reasons behind these behaviors are quite surprising, like why cats purr and what it means when dogs wag their tails…
